Statute of Limitations

The statute of limitations is a legal term that specifies the maximum period during which the victims and their families have to file a lawsuit against asbestos. The time limit is determined by state law and varies according to the state. Victims must consult an experienced mesothelioma lawyer ensure that their claim is filed before the deadline.

If a victim or their family member misses the filing deadline, they may lose out on the financial compensation they deserve for their losses and injuries. Mesothelioma attorneys can help clients know the time limit in their state and help them prepare a solid asbestos law mesothelioma case.

Contrary to other personal injury claims that involve asbestos exposure, asbestos-related claims are usually subject to special rules governing the statute of limitation. For instance, many states have what is known as the discovery rule. The discovery rule means that the clock for extending the statute of limitations doesn't begin to tick until a person is diagnosed with an asbestos-related illness. This is due to the fact that many asbestos-related diseases, such as mesothelioma, are not discovered until years after exposure to the toxic material.

According to a 1973 court case in the Eastern District of Texas (Borel v. Fibreboard Paper Products Corporation) The discovery rule was established to safeguard asbestos plaintiffs. If the statute of limitations were interpreted the same way as it is in other personal injury cases, the majority of victims would not be able to sue as the time to file a claim is so long for mesothelioma.

How to Claim VA Benefits

It is essential to be aware of how to claim disability benefits if you're an ex-military veteran suffering from a debilitating medical condition. You might think that the condition is related to military service. There are a number of steps that need to be followed in order for your claim to be successful.

The first step is to apply for an Intent to File. This grants you the opportunity to collect all of the necessary medical evidence prior to filing your actual VA claim. This will allow you to avoid rushing through medical appointments or failing to submit vital documents. This allows you to maximize your back pay.

You will receive an email notice or a letter from the VA after you have filed your Intent to file. This will let you know that your claim has been received and is currently being processed. They will also let you know if additional information is needed to determine the merits of your claim. This can be for a variety of reasons, including that the doctor has not provided an opinion that is clear and concise or they have not had time to request specific documents from your private medical providers.

A Veteran Service Representative, who is a VA employee, will review your claim after it has reached the Preparation for decision phase. This is to ensure that they have all the necessary information to decide on your disability compensation claim. This includes federal records (such your DD214 and Social Security Administration Disability Claims) as well as private medical files that relate to the condition you're seeking benefits for.

Your VSR will arrange an appointment with a doctor to determine the severity of your condition. In most cases, your doctor can perform a Functional and Physical Exam (F&P) in order to make the determination. There are instances when the VA will ask you to undergo a medical test they consider essential.

If your claim has been denied due to reasons of any kind, it's a good idea to contact your local Congressional Representative's office and ask them for assistance. Their staff has a good amount of experience working with the VA and can often help speed up the process by requesting more information or advancing your claim to the top of their priority list of claims.
